Scope
This document specifies a method for determining the ultimate aerobic biodegradability and disintegration degree of materials as organic compounds under controlled composting conditions by measuring the amount of carbon dioxide emitted. This method simulates the typical aerobic composting conditions for organic components mixed into urban solid waste. The test materials are exposed to inoculum produced by composting under environmental conditions where temperature, oxygen concentration, and humidity are strictly monitored and controlled. This method determines the percentage of carbon converted into released carbon dioxide in the test materials. Sections 8.6 and 8.7 specify a method for determining the percentage of carbon converted into released carbon dioxide in the test materials using mineral solid beds instead of composted inoculum (obtained from compost through special processing methods). The conditions described in this document do not always correspond to the optimal conditions for achieving maximum biodegradation.
